# Break-Glass: Catalog Cache Invalidation

Scope: the Pinrow product catalog at Veldstone Retail. If stale prices persist after a purge and the Hollowmere invalidation queue is wedged, use break-glass to flush the edge tier directly. Contractors: get verbal sign-off from the catalog lead first. Steps: open the Hollowmere admin shell, select emergency-flush, confirm the tenant, and run it once — repeated flushes thrash the origin. Access is logged and expires after 20 minutes. Unseal the admin shell with the passphrase below.

recovery phrase for kahop-tajog: istix-casvan

While carving the user module out of the Bellcourt monolith, we discovered that staging has accumulated overrides that never landed in the prod manifests — session TTLs, the consent-flag default, and the shadow-read toggle all differ. This makes the dual-write validation numbers from last sprint unreliable, so please treat the Tuesday report as provisional. Proposed fix: declare a single canonical manifest and regenerate both environments from it. For reference, the intended canonical configuration is as follows.

deployment values, kajep-kageg:
[praix]
host = praix.paliqcorp.corp
user = praix_svc
database = praix_prod

Subject: retry logic for failed exports — quick look?

Hey Mirela, pushed the retry branch for the Saffron export worker. Failed exports now back off exponentially (30s, 2m, 8m) and park in a dead-letter table after three strikes instead of silently vanishing. I kept the old synchronous path behind a flag in case ops gets nervous. Should be a small diff, mostly in export_retry.go. It's all in the build tagged below.

build token for yajof-bajof: htk31_506ff1188f74596b5bb2eec94edc43c